WebPsychiatrists are generally the highest charging (and highest earning) mental health professional, generally followed by psychologists, social workers, and counselors. As perhaps expected, New York providers charge the most per session: Median session fees in NYC range from $150 (for social workers) to $400 (for psychiatrists).

WebFor psychologists who hold a PsyD or PhD, the APA recommends using this psychology licensing requirements directory provided by the Association of State and Provincial Psychology Boards (ASPPB).
